Headless durable releases
The devkit release commands use the same release application, request
validation, run store and bounded executors as the
release console. They invoke its ASGI application inside
the current process, with an ephemeral internal token. No listening socket,
background server, browser session or externally supplied console URL is used.
The development environment's FastAPI/HTTPX dependencies load only when a
release command runs; ordinary devkit help does not import them.
This is a GovOPlaN-specific provider. Repository and origin authority still comes
from the release service's registered catalog. --project is explicitly rejected
for release commands; a portable project configuration must not silently override
that authority. A different workspace path does not authorize arbitrary release
repositories, remotes, commands, signing policies or source bindings.
The default compact output includes the overall status, selected repository
states and versions, source-preflight readiness, bounded gate findings and the
recommended next action. Run inspection also shows step-state counts and the
first outstanding steps. These are projections of the service response, not new
readiness checks. Use --json for the complete existing plan or receipt; compact
output deliberately omits executor commands, arguments and source bindings.

Create and transition commands require caller-chosen --request-id values.
Retain the same ID for an uncertain replay of the same command; changing
inputs under an existing ID fails closed. No command automatically retries a
mutation. These commands perform one explicit transition, not an implicit
"release everything" loop.
Read commands do not commit, tag, push, publish or apply database migrations.
The existing private run store can initialize its lock directory or upgrade a
legacy record while inspecting it; this does not advance release steps.
--include-migrations requests the existing audits, never migration application.
--online, --remote-tags and --public-catalog are explicit network-check
choices. A generic step preview describes frozen intent; it is not a claim that
live preflight, remote identity or release acceptance has passed.
Example: review, freeze and execute one step
Run the devkit through the workspace ./devkit entrypoint. These examples put
global options before release:
./devkit --workspace-root /path/to/workspace --format json release plan \
--repo-version govoplan-files=0.1.9
./devkit --workspace-root /path/to/workspace release create \
--repo-version govoplan-files=0.1.9 --request-id files-release-create-0001
./devkit --workspace-root /path/to/workspace release create \
--repo-version govoplan-files=0.1.9 --request-id files-release-create-0001 --apply
./devkit --workspace-root /path/to/workspace release show RUN_ID
./devkit --workspace-root /path/to/workspace release preview RUN_ID STEP_ID
./devkit --workspace-root /path/to/workspace release execute RUN_ID STEP_ID \
--request-id files-release-step-0001 --confirm REQUIRED_CONFIRMATION --apply
RUN_ID, STEP_ID and REQUIRED_CONFIRMATION stand for the actual values
returned by the frozen run. For read-only preflight/alignment/install-verification
steps, omit --confirm when the service reports an empty confirmation. Metadata,
commit, release-lock, source-tag, source-push, candidate-generation and catalog
publication steps keep the existing UPDATE, COMMIT, LOCK, TAG, PUBLISH,
GENERATE and PUSH confirmations respectively. Prerequisite ordering is enforced
by the same store; a later step cannot be forced through this adapter.
Version selection supports repeated --repo-version REPO=VERSION, or repeated
--repo REPO with --target-version VERSION. Every created run needs explicit
versions for all selected repositories. Conflicting version assignments are
rejected. Planning is selective; repositories are never silently selected merely
because their worktrees are dirty.
Candidate publication and recovery
Use the frozen run's catalog:selective-generator and
catalog:validate-sign-publish steps, not the disabled legacy mutation endpoints.
Generation accepts repeated --signing-key KEY_ID=PRIVATE_KEY_FILE; these are
operator-owned key-file references, never inline key material. Signing arguments
are not emitted in devkit JSON or persisted by the adapter. Publication consumes
the candidate receipt created by that run, not an arbitrary candidate directory.
The existing source/runtime trust, immutable tag/remote identity, private
candidate checks and exact commit-delta checks remain authoritative.
After an interrupted write, inspect the run and the actual local/remote effect.
Use resume --apply if an attempt was left running. Then use reconcile with
effect_absent, effect_succeeded or unresolved, --confirm RECONCILE, a new
reconciliation request ID and --apply. Successful reconciliation still performs
the service's independent receipt checks. An unresolved effect must not be
retried or papered over by generating a new request ID. A failed/read-only
attempt may use retry --apply and a new explicit execute attempt only when
the existing lifecycle makes that safe.
State and limitations
Every successful response exposes state_location and candidate_location.
Without --state-dir, the adapter uses the console's existing default private,
workspace-fingerprinted state directory. With --state-dir PATH, it uses
PATH/release-console/workspace-<fingerprint>/release-runs. Workspaces cannot
read or resume one another's runs. Existing ownership, symlink, permission,
retention and record-integrity checks are unchanged.
Release preparation can commit only the recognized, receipt-bound metadata
changes its executors produced. This command does not stage arbitrary source
changes, use git add -A, force-push, retarget tags or enable the disabled generic
prepare/sync/push endpoints. Normal selected-path maintenance requires its own
explicit reviewed-change workflow; it is not silently folded into release.
